Looking for partition resizing tool that support windows 64bit server
This is windows 2003 64bit server. I want to resize C: drive as it is running out of space. Any commercial product(s) to recommend? How about the reliablility?
Acronis Disk Director Server is pretty nice and works on servers as well as Windows 7.

I'd opt to use GPartEd, an open source tool, download an ISO image here http://gparted.sourceforge.net/download.php,
burn it on CD, boot from it and resize.
